Account Specialist / Dispatcher Job Description
Position Summary / Objective

The Account Specialist / Dispatcher is responsible for managing customer accounts, coordinating daily dispatch and routing activities, and ensuring accurate and timely delivery of services. This role serves as a key liaison between customers, drivers, warehouse personnel, and internal operations teams to support customer satisfaction, operational efficiency, and service reliability.

The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ment. This position requires strong commun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and the capacity to make real-time decisions while maintaining exceptional customer service standards.

Dispatch & Routing Coordination
  • Plan, create, and optimize daily delivery routes to maximize efficiency and minimize operational costs.
  • Dispatch drivers with accurate route information, delivery instructions, and special handling requirements.
  • Monitor route progress and driver performance using dispatch and GPS tracking systems.
  • Communicate with drivers to provide updates, resolve delivery issues, and ensure adherence to schedules.
  • Adjust routes and schedules in response to traffic conditions, customer changes, cancellations, or operational needs.
  • Coordinate with warehouse, operations, and customer service teams to ensure proper order preparation and delivery sequencing.
  • Maintain dispatch records, route sheets, delivery confirmations, and operational documentation.
  • Ensure compliance with DOT regulations, company safety standards, and operational procedures.
